wxWidgets ออกรุ่น 3.0

by lew
12 November 2013 - 17:02

ชุดเครื่องมือออกแบบซอฟต์แวร์เป็น GUI รุ่นลายครามอย่าง wxWidgets ออกรุ่น 3.0 แล้วหลังจากออกรุ่น 2.0 มานานกว่าสิบปี (ออกปี 1999) และหลายปีหลังรุ่นหลักรุ่นสุดท้ายคือ 2.8

ตัวโครงการ wxWidgets หลักยังคงซัพพอร์ต C++ อย่างเดียวเช่นเดิม ส่วนภาษาอื่นๆ ต้องรอโครงการรอบๆ อัพเดตตามกันมาอีกครั้ง ความโดดเด่นของ wxWidgets คือรองรับแพลตฟอร์มต่างๆ กันได้ค่อนข้างเป็นธรรมชาติ หน้าตาของซอฟต์แวร์ที่ออกมากลมกลืนกลับสภาพแวดล้อม โดยรับสามแพลตฟอร์มหลักคือ วินโดวส์, ลินุกซ์ (ผ่าน GTK2 และ GTK3), และ OS X (ผ่าน Cocoa)

ฟีเจอร์สำคัญที่เพิ่มเข้ามาได้แก่

  • รองรับ unicode ในตัว ใช้ wchar_t ในภาษา C ได้เลย
  • รองรับการแสดงผลเว็บด้วย wxWebView
  • ปรับปรุงกระบวนการดีบั๊ก

โค้ดที่เปลี่ยนทั้งหมดรวมเป็น 320,000 บรรทัด ทำให้ wxWidgets มีโค้ดรวมกว่าล้านบรรทัด โค้ดจำนวนมากที่เพิ่มมาเป็นส่วนของเอกสาร, ระบบเทส, และตัวอย่างโค้ด

ที่มา - wxBlog, wx-announce

Blognone Jobs Premium